Goose Idioms

Here are 20 goose idioms in English.

1. Kill the goose that lays the golden eggs

Meaning: Destroy something valuable.
Example: He gambled away his business, killing the goose that laid the golden eggs.

2. Cook someone’s goose

Meaning: Ruin someone’s plans.
Example: I forgot the documents and cooked my own goose.

3. Goose is cooked

Meaning: Situation is hopeless.
Example: When the boss saw the mistake, my goose was cooked.

4. What’s sauce for the goose is sauce for the gander

Meaning: What applies to one applies to all.
Example: She takes long lunches, so I guess I can too.

5. Silly goose

Meaning: A term for someone being foolish.
Example: Don’t be a silly goose and risk your health.

6. Goose bumps

Meaning: Small bumps from cold or fear.
Example: That scary movie gave me goose bumps.

7. Wild goose chase

Meaning: A futile search or pursuit.
Example: Finding that book was a wild goose chase.

8. Goose step

Meaning: March like a soldier without bending knees.
Example: The troops did a goose step during the parade.

9. Goose egg

Meaning: A score of zero.
Example: Our team scored a goose egg yesterday.

10. Get someone’s goose

Meaning: Affect someone significantly.
Example: That prank really got his goose.
